Who is Ryan Seacrest?
Ryan John Seacrest, born December 24, 1974, is an American radio personality, television host, and producer. He's best known for hosting *American Idol* (2002-2016, 2018-present), *On Air with Ryan Seacrest*, and *Live with Kelly and Ryan* (later *Live with Kelly and Mark*). Beyond his on-air roles, Seacrest is a savvy businessman, founding Ryan Seacrest Productions (RSP), which produces successful reality shows like *Keeping Up with the Kardashians* and its numerous spin-offs. He also holds a significant stake in iHeartMedia, one of the largest radio conglomerates in the United States.

When Did He Become a Household Name?
Seacrest's career trajectory began in radio, but his national breakthrough came with *American Idol* in 2002. The show's massive popularity catapulted him to stardom. Nielsen ratings consistently ranked *American Idol* as one of the most-watched programs in the US during its peak years, reaching over 30 million viewers per episode. His subsequent roles, including hosting *E! News* and eventually landing the *Live with Kelly* gig in 2017, further solidified his position in the entertainment industry.

Current Developments:
In 2023, Seacrest announced his departure from *Live with Kelly and Ryan*, marking the end of a six-year run. He was replaced by Mark Consuelos, Kelly Ripa's husband, and the show was rebranded as *Live with Kelly and Mark*. Seacrest cited his increasing workload and desire to focus on other projects, including *American Idol*, as reasons for his departure.
This move signals a potential shift in Seacrest's priorities, possibly indicating a greater focus on behind-the-scenes production and business ventures. His continued involvement with *American Idol* suggests a commitment to his roots and a recognition of the show's enduring value.
